Mangel.1468
Description Mangel.1468
It is not a dangerous memory resident stealth parasitic virus. It hooks INT 21h and writes itself to the end of EXE files that are accessed. The virus deletes the anti-virus data files CHKLIST.MS and ANTI-VIR.DAT. The virus contains the text string: mangel

Ph33r
Description Ph33r
It is a harmless memory resident parasitic virus. While executing an infected program the virus hooks INT 21h and stays memory resident. In case of DOS host file the virus uses the standard methods of the INT 21h hooking, in case of NewEXE file the virus uses DPMI calls. While opening, execution, renaming executable files including NewEXE, and on changing the file attributes the virus writes itself at the end of the file. The virus checks the file length and infects only *.DL*, *.CO* and *.EX* files. The virus does not infect the *AV.*, *DV.*, *AN.*, *OT.* files. While executing COM and EXE files the virus writes itself to the end of the file. While infecting a NewEXE file the virus moves NE header 8 bytes up, creates new descriptor there, and writes itself the end of the file. The virus does not manifest itself. It contains the text strings: =Ph33r= Qark/VLAD
On October 21st "Ph33r.1460" displays: Cheng Cheng: Happy Birthday to you, HandSome Boy!
This virus also contains the text: > Joan for Windows v1.0 of T.N.T. Taipei/Taiwan 1995/09 <
Phantasmagoria
Description Phantasmagoria
It is not a dangerous nonmemory resident parasitic virus. It searches for .COM files of the current directory and writes itself to the end of the file. Before return to the host program it decrypts and displays the message: PHANTASMAGORIA ! Sleep Well
It set INT 20h to JMP RESET instruction and if the host program terminates by INT 20h call, the computer reboots.
